Inspection/Report History

Where possible, ChildcareCenter provides inspection reports as a service to families. This information is deemed reliable but is not guaranteed. We encourage families to contact the daycare provider directly with any questions or concerns. Reports can also be verified with your local daycare licensing office.

Date Type Violations Rule
2024-01-04 Unannounced Inspection No
2023-10-26 Unannounced Inspection No
2023-08-28 Unannounced Inspection No
2023-07-06 Unannounced Inspection No
2023-05-22 Unannounced Inspection Yes
2023-05-22 Violation 807 10A NCAC 09 .0601(a)
A safe indoor and outdoor environment was not provided for the children. On May 18, 2023, staff members failed to provide a safe environment for a five-year-old child when the staff members left the child unsupervised in the facility vehicle for approximately one (1) hour, placing the child at significant risk of harm.
2023-05-22 Violation 1118 GS 110-91 (13); .1003(g)
Children were left in a vehicle unattended by an adult. On May 18, 2023, two staff members left a five year old child unattended in the facility van for approximately one (1) hour.
2023-05-22 Violation 1128 10A NCAC 09 .1003(l)
For routine transport of children to and from the center, staff did not use the list to document attendance as children boarded and departed the vehicle. On May 18 2023, a staff member did not use the attendance list as children departed the facility van, resulting in a five year old child, being left alone in the vehicle for approximately one (1) hour.
2023-05-22 Violation 1810 GS 110-105.6(a)
There was a substantiation of child maltreatment. Pursuant to its investigation, the Division has confirmed sufficient information to determine child maltreatment.
2023-01-09 Unannounced Inspection Yes
2023-01-09 Violation 1048 .1102(c)
All staff did not successfully complete certification in First Aid appropriate to the age of children in care. Verification of staff completion of First Aid training from an approved training organization was not in the staff file. One staff did successfully complete certification in First Aid appropriate to the age of children in care.
2023-01-09 Violation 1049 .1102(d)
All staff did not successfully complete certification in CPR training appropriate to the age of the children in care. Verification of staff completion of the CPR course from an approved training organization was not in the staff file. One staff did not successfully complete certification in CPR training appropriate to the age of the children in care.
2022-08-24 Unannounced Inspection No
2022-02-18 Unannounced Inspection Yes
2022-02-18 Violation 1867 .0605(k)(1-4)
The depth of the loose surfacing was not based on critical height of the equipment. The depth of surfacing under the playground structure measured 5 inches.
